Posco develops stainless steel for desulfurization facilities

Korean media reported that Posco, the largest South Korean steelmaker, has succeeded in developing core materials used in desulfurization facilities at industrial plants.

Posco has developed three types of high alloy stainless steel that can be used to make absorbers, gas-gas heaters and zero liquid discharge equipment, all of which can help cut sulphur oxide emissions in industrial plants such as steel plants, oil refineries and thermoelectric power plants.

The new types of steel are specially designed to withstand corrosion under harsh conditions. Posco said its high alloy stainless steels have been under development for about two years, have undergone field tests to prove their high quality, and have recently been supplied to a desulfurization facility producer in South Korea.
